As a master of fine art, Dennis has been sculpting in wood for many years.

Dennis was invited by an anthroposophical art gallery in the Jarna Community of Sweden to a virtual art show. We created several videos using his art and stories to share with them.


Some of Dennis more recent sculptures have been meditative storytelling pieces. Please enjoy.

“That” in the Land of Darkened Minds

In a land of very fine dust, peoples act out their differences to tragic results. A modern myth told through the sculpture work of Dennis Klocek.


I, a pilgrim

A one foot tall art piece tells the story of initiation on the path to spiritual clarity. The challenges and triumphs along the way are told through Dennis Klocek’s symbolic storytelling wooden sculpture.
